Based on the data from the years 2003 - 2018 the average number of fire incidents per year is 12. The highest number of fire incidents - 30 took place in 2011, and the least - 0 in 2005. The data has a constant trend.
37.5% incidents where reported in the morning and 62.5% in the evening. The most fires (15.6%) took place on Monday, and the least (10.9%) on Tuesday.
Based on the 192 incident reports from years 2003 - 2018 most fires (14.1%) took place during April, and the least (3.6%) in February.
